Today watched the Samsara. I never watch Baraka yet. So, can't give comparison between these 2 non-narrative documentary. The whole documentary only have music (or sometimes, someone singing) and background sound. You can't even select subtitle since there is not subtitle at all.
Samsara focus more on circle of life and some of the scenes are showing dead people ( as shown in trailer) But for me, I think, I still prefer narrative documentary over non-narrative documentary. |
